The Importance of Proper Grounding in Outlets

A properly grounded outlet provides a safe path for electrical current to follow in the event of a fault โ€” preventing electric shock and reducing fire risk. If your Manhattan Beach home was built before the 1960s, you may still have ungrounded two-prong outlets. While these outlets work fine for basic devices, they provide no protection against ground faults and cannot safely power three-prong appliances, computers, or surge protectors.

Upgrading to grounded three-prong outlets in an older home isn’t always straightforward โ€” it depends on whether grounding conductors exist in the wiring. If your home has armored cable (BX) or metal conduit, the metal sheathing may serve as a grounding path. If your home has older non-metallic cable without a ground wire, options include running new grounded circuits, adding GFCI protection (which provides shock protection without a ground wire), or a combination approach. Outlet and Switch Upgrades for Modern Manhattan Beach Living

The outlets and switches in your Manhattan Beach home do more than provide power โ€” they’re the daily interface between you and your electrical system. Outdated outlets can be inconvenient (no USB ports, not enough receptacles), unsafe (no tamper resistance, no GFCI/AFCI protection), or simply worn out (loose plugs, intermittent connections). Modern outlet and switch options include: USB outlets with built-in USB-A and USB-C charging ports, tamper-resistant receptacles (required by code in all new installations) with spring-loaded shutters that prevent children from inserting objects, weather-resistant outlets for outdoor use, and smart switches with dimming, scheduling, and voice control capabilities.

If plugs fall out of your outlets, if outlets feel warm, if you see sparks when plugging in devices, or if your outlets are the old ungrounded two-prong type, it’s time for an upgrade. Where Automatic Transfer Switch (ATS) Installation Is Needed in Your Manhattan Beach Home

๐Ÿ  Kitchen

Modern kitchens need more outlets than ever. Code requires countertop receptacles every 4 feet and within 2 feet of a sink. Adding USB outlets eliminates counter clutter from phone chargers. Dedicated 20-amp circuits are required for kitchen outlets.

๐Ÿ  Home Office

A dedicated circuit with plenty of outlets keeps your home office equipment running safely. Consider outlets with built-in USB-C for charging laptops and phones, and add a dedicated circuit for computer equipment.

๐Ÿ  Living Room

Floor outlets in the middle of large living rooms eliminate the need for extension cords to furniture islands. Tamper-resistant outlets are required by code in all living spaces to protect children.

๐Ÿ  Garage & Workshop

Garages need GFCI-protected outlets at workbench height, plus 240V outlets for welders, compressors, or EV chargers. Adding enough outlets now prevents the dangerous practice of daisy-chaining extension cords.

What causes outlets to spark when I plug something in?

A brief spark when inserting a plug can be normal (especially with motors or high-draw devices). However, large sparks, sparks with a burning smell, or sparks from outlets that feel warm indicate loose connections, damaged wiring, or a failing outlet โ€” all of which need immediate professional attention.

Should I upgrade to tamper-resistant outlets?

Tamper-resistant receptacles are required by current NEC code for all new outlet installations in dwellings. They have spring-loaded shutters that prevent children from inserting objects. If your Manhattan Beach home has standard outlets, upgrading to tamper-resistant during any outlet replacement is a smart safety improvement.

Can you add outlets to a room without tearing up walls?

In most cases, yes. We route new wiring through attics, crawl spaces, and existing wall cavities to add outlets with minimal wall damage. We may need to cut small access holes (which we patch) or use surface-mount conduit for exposed installations in garages and basements.

How many outlets does my Manhattan Beach home need per room?

NEC code requires a receptacle within 6 feet of any point along a wall (meaning outlets every 12 feet maximum), plus an outlet within 6 feet of any doorway. Kitchens require countertop outlets every 4 feet. Bathrooms need at least one outlet within 3 feet of the sink. These are minimums โ€” we often recommend additional outlets for convenience.

3. Is an ATS required for all backup generators in Manhattan Beach homes?

While not strictly required for all portable generators, an ATS is highly recommended and often essential for permanently installed standby generators. It ensures the safest and most efficient transfer of power, protecting your appliances and preventing dangerous back-feeding to the utility grid, which is especially important in densely populated areas like Manhattan Beach.

5. How quickly does an ATS switch power in Manhattan Beach during an outage?

The transition is remarkably fast, typically occurring within seconds of the utility power failing. Most ATS units detect the outage, signal the generator to start, and then transfer the load once the generator reaches stable voltage and frequency.
